Is a 1000 gallon septic tank big enough?

Most residential septic tanks range in size from 750 gallons to 1,250 gallons. An average 3-bedroom home, less than 2500 square feet will probably require a 1000 gallon tank. A properly sized septic tank should hold waste for 3-years before needing to be pumped and cleaned.

Is a 500 gallon septic tank big enough?

A rule of thumb is the tank should be at least 400 gallons bigger than the amount of water it’ll handle. For example, if your water usage per day is 500 gallons then the septic tank should be 900 gallons.

How often does a 1000 gallon septic tank need to be pumped?

For example, a 1,000 gallon septic tank, which is used by two people, should be pumped every 5.9 years. If there are eight people using a 1,000-gallon septic tank, it should be pumped every year.

Minimum Septic Tank Capacity Table

For further information on the minimum septic tank capacity dependent on the number of residential bedrooms, please see the following table:

Number of Bedrooms Minimum Septic Tank Size Minimum Liquid Surface Area Drainfield Size
2 or less 1000 – 1500 Gallons 27 Sq. Ft. 800 – 2500 Sq. Ft.
3 1000 – 2000 Gallons 27 Sq. Ft. 1000 – 2880 Sq. Ft.
4 1250 – 2500 Gallons 34 Sq. Ft. 1200 – 3200 Sq. Ft.
5 1500 – 3000 Gallons 40 Sq. Ft. 1600 – 3400 Sq. Ft.
6 1750 – 3500 Gallons 47 Sq. Ft. 2000 – 3800 Sq. Ft.

Take note of the following in relation to the table above:

  • As defined by the State of New York, the Minimum Liquid Surface Area is the surface area given for the liquid by the tank’s width and length measurements. The range of Drainfield Sizes is depending on the kind of groundwater present. The State of Michigan provides the above-mentioned drainfield recommendations, which might vary greatly depending on local standards and terrain.

Why Septic Tank Size Matters

It is your septic tank’s job to collect and treat all of the water that exits your home through your toilets, showers, laundry, and kitchen sinks. For as long as 24 hours, the water may be kept in the tank, which also serves as a separation chamber where solids are removed from liquids in the process. When it comes to separating particles from liquids, the retention time is critical. The presence of bacteria in the tank aids in the breakdown of sediments. The size of the tank has an impact on how successfully the system can separate and break down the waste materials.

Although it might seem logical to believe that a larger tank is preferable, a tank that is too large for your water usage can interfere with the formation of germs. This can have an impact on the tank’s efficiency.

Assessing Septic System Sizing For Tank And Drain Field

However, it is a frequent fallacy that the size of the system is governed by the size of the home; however, this is not completely correct. The size of the septic system is normally established by taking into consideration how many bedrooms the house has, or more specifically, how many projected residents there will be and how much water will be used on a daily basis (litres per day). Because everything that goes into a septic system must eventually come out, water consumption is a crucial consideration when sizing a septic system.

The size of a septic system must be determined by ensuring that the septic tank and drain field are both large enough to handle the amount of wastewater created by the residents of the property.

Things to Consider when Sizing a Septic Tank

It is necessary to size a septic tank appropriately so that the retention time — the amount of time that wastewater effluent remains in the tank before being discharged to the drain field — is long enough to allow heavier solid particulates, such as fats and oils, to settle to the bottom of the tank as sludge and lighter solids, such as grease and oils, to float to the top of the tank and join the layer of scum that has formed above it.

The presence of a significant amount of liquid in the tank is required for this method to be successful in order to aid the settling process.

If you have a three-bedroom house or a property with fewer than three bedrooms, you should have at least 850-1000 gallons of storage space in your septic tank (3900 litres).

Things to Consider when Sizing a Drain Field

It can be difficult to determine the most appropriate size for a drain field because it must take into account not only the amount of water used by the household and the rate at which it is used, but also the soil characteristics of the site where the drain field will be constructed, as well as the quality of the effluent entering the drain field. It is also possible to create trenches at a shallow depth — in this instance, trenches are partly below ground and partially covered, or “at grade.” As shown, the infiltration surface is at its original grade, and the system has been covered with cover dirt to prevent erosion.

The horizontal basal area ONLY (not including the sidewall area) should be at least equal to the AIS (Daily Design Flow divided by the Hydraulic Loading Rate or HLR).

The area of the trench infiltrative bottom required equals the area of the infiltrative surface (AIS) Hydraulic loading rate divided by daily design flow equals Area of the Infiltrative Surface (AI). The total length of trenches is equal to the product of the AIS and the trench width.

Sizing a Septic Drain Field, Calculation Example

1300L/day daily design flow for a three-bedroom house with a high permeability ratio of 30 L/day/m2 for Loamy Sand (high sand content with a tiny percent of clay) and trenches 0.6 m wide. Trench bottom area is calculated as 1300L/D/m2 x 30L/D/m2 = 43.33 m2. trenches total length = 43.33 0.6 = 72.2 m total trench length We need to know how soon the soil can absorb the wastewater because the soil is responsible for absorbing it. It is known as the percolation rate, which is the rate at which water may be absorbed by the soil.

It is possible for sewage to rise up and pool on the surface of the soil, resulting in an unpleasant and unhealthy environment; however, if the soil percolation rate is too fast, the effluent will not be properly treated before it filters into the groundwater, resulting in an unpleasant and unhealthy environment.

GRAVITY TRENCH DISTRIBUTION DESIGN CONSIDERATIONS

As a possible system reserve area, the inter-trenching spacing might be considered. No less than 30.5 cm (1′) and no more than 90 cm (3′) should be used for trench width. For any one lateral in a gravity distribution system, the length of the trench should not exceed 15 m (50′).

It is preferable for non-dosed gravity systems to employ shorter laterals (less than 50 feet). In all except the most extreme cases, such as pressured shallow narrow drain fields, the spacing between center lines should not be less than 1.8 m (6′).

Using water usage to determine the septic tank size

The number of bedrooms on a property must be taken into consideration when deciding the size of the septic tank to be installed. This is mostly due to the fact that the number of bedrooms will provide a clear indication of the maximum number of people who will be able to accommodate the property. You want to be sure that the septic tank is the appropriate size since all of the wastewater from the house will make its first stop there. The effluent should be allowed to sit in the tank for at least 24 hours before it is discharged into the drainfield or sewer system.

Other than that, the solids will flow out of the tank and into the drain field, causing the field to get clogged and eventually clogging up. The recommended septic tank sizes for a certain number of bedrooms are listed in the table below.

USE FLOW RATE (GALLONS PER MINUTE) TOTAL USE (GALLONS)
Bathroom sink 2 1-2
Backwash filters 10 100-200 /backwash cycle
Garbage disposer 3 4-6 per day
Dishwasher 2 5/load
Kitchen sink 3 2-4/use
Shower/ tub 5 25-60/use
Toilet flush (pre-1992 design) 3 4-7/use
Toilet flush (high-efficiency design) 3 1.28/use
Washing machine 5 15-30/load

How to Calculate a Tank’s Capacity in Gallons?

If the tank is rectangular in shape, the dimensions are as follows: Length x Width x Depth in feet x 7.5 = gallons If the tank is circular, the cubic capacity is equal to 3.14 x the radius squared x the depth (all in feet). Cubic capacity multiplied by 7.5 equals gallon capacity. There are various elements that influence the size of the septic tank that should be installed. They’re right here!

Using the Number of Bedrooms in the House

Regulations such as this one determine the average use based on the assumption of two persons per bedroom. To be on the safe side, follow this formula: there are two persons in every bedroom, and each person requires 100 gallons of water. Then, add 400 gallons to the mix. This should provide you with a good idea of how large your tank should be in terms of volume. For example, if you have three bedrooms and six people, 600 + 400 equals a 1100 gallon tank.
